On September 28, staff at Sacred Heart Health Centre in McLennan celebrated the 30th anniversary of the opening of the current hospital in 1988.
At the time of the 1988 official opening, then Chairman of the Board, John Guerin acknowledged and thanked the many groups and individuals who played a role in bringing to reality what he called 19-years of planning, giving special mention to the hospital’s former board of directors.
The grand opening took place on September 30 at 2pm and tours of the new facility were offered between 3pm and 5pm.
Along with Chairman John Guerin, the other Sacred Heart Health Centre board members at the time of the official opening were Brian Hrab, Administrator – Gerry Hachey, Assistant Administrator – Larry Meardi, Vice Chairman and Trustees Claude Sirois, Joe Chaibos and Andre Bremont.
A special roast beef dinner took place at Guy-Donnelly Sportex with Ron Schuster as master of ceremonies.
Greetings were offered by Administrator Brian Hrab and Solicitor General Marvin Moore. The music for the event was provided by ‘Better Days.’
To celebrate the 30th anniversary, site administrator Barbara Mader invited the entire staff to the cafeteria to share in a slice of special anniversary cake, coffee and refreshments.
